谢祖芳 %A 童张法 %A 陈渊 %A 庞起 %A 黄艳 %A 何雪玲 %J 环境工程学报 %D 2012 %I %X The adsorption and desorption of aqueous picric acid solution onto D301R weaky basic anion exchange resin were investigated. The kinetics, thermodynamics and adsorption mechanism were also studied. The results showed that the maximum adsorption ability of resin occured at pH = 2.7 ~ 10.2. The adsorption of picric acid on the resin obeyed Freundlich isotherm and was a spontaneous, endothermal and entropy increasing process. Kinetic analysis shows that the adsorption reaction could be approximated by a Lagergren pseudo-second-order-rate equation for which the intraparticle diffusion is the rate-controlling process with an adsorption rate constant of 7.23×10-5 ~ 1.20×10-4 g/(mg·min) and activity energy of 19.4 kJ/mol. Washout rate of 99% of the picric acid adsorbed on the resin can be eluted with a HNO3 + acetone solution quantitatively. The comparison of static adsorption and desorption confirmed the presence of irreversible chemical adsorption in the adsorption process. The synergistic interactions by the electrostatic, acid-base complex and hydrogen bonding were the main driving forces of picric acid adsorption on the weaky basic resin. %K picric acid %K weaky basic resin %K adsorption thermodynamics %K kinetics %K desorption
